Calcul du factoriel d'un nombre : méthodes et astuces

Lorsque vous devez calculer le factoriel d'un nombre, il existe plusieurs méthodes et astuces qui peuvent vous aider à obtenir rapidement et efficacement le résultat souhaité. Dans cet article, nous explorerons différentes approches pour calculer le factoriel d'un nombre.

Qu'est-ce que le factoriel d'un nombre ?

Le factoriel d'un nombre, noté n!, est le produit de tous les entiers positifs inférieurs ou égaux à n. Par exemple, le factoriel de 5 est représenté par 5! et équivaut à 5 × 4 × 3 × 2 × 1 = 120.

Méthode itérative pour calculer le factoriel

Une méthode couramment utilisée pour calculer le factoriel d'un nombre est l'utilisation d'une boucle itérative. Voici un exemple de code en langage Python pour calculer le factoriel d'un nombre :

  • Initialisez une variable résultat à 1.
  • Utilisez une boucle pour multiplier le résultat par tous les entiers de 1 à n.
  • Une fois la boucle terminée, le résultat contient le factoriel du nombre.

Voici l'exemple de code en Python :

def calcul_factoriel(n):
    resultat = 1
    for i in range(1, n+1):
        resultat *= i
    return resultat

nombre = 5
factoriel = calcul_factoriel(nombre)
print(f"Le factoriel de {nombre} est : {factoriel}")

Récursion pour calculer le factoriel

Une autre approche pour calculer le factoriel d'un nombre est d'utiliser la récursion. La récursion est un processus où une fonction s'appelle elle-même jusqu'à atteindre une condition d'arrêt. Voici un exemple de code en langage Python pour calculer le factoriel d'un nombre en utilisant la récursion :

def calcul_factoriel(n):
    if n == 0:
        return 1
    else:
        return n * calcul_factoriel(n-1)

nombre = 5
factoriel = calcul_factoriel(nombre)
print(f"Le factoriel de {nombre} est : {factoriel}")

Astuce : Utilisation de la formule de Stirling

La formule de Stirling est une approximation mathématique très utile pour calculer des factoriels de grands nombres. Elle s'exprime comme suit :

n! ≈ √(2πn) * (n / e)^n

Cette formule permet d'obtenir une estimation assez précise du factoriel d'un nombre, même pour des valeurs élevées de n. Cependant, gardez à l'esprit qu'il s'agit d'une approximation et non du résultat exact.

Utiliser la formule de Stirling peut être particulièrement utile lorsqu'il est nécessaire de calculer rapidement des factoriels de grands nombres.

Calculer le factoriel d'un nombre peut être réalisé en utilisant différentes méthodes telles que la méthode itérative, la récursion ou même en utilisant des approximations mathématiques comme la formule de Stirling. Il est important de choisir l'approche la plus adaptée en fonction de vos besoins spécifiques.

Avec ces méthodes et astuces, vous serez en mesure de calculer facilement le factoriel d'un nombre et d'optimiser vos calculs mathématiques.

Quest'articolo è stato scritto a titolo esclusivamente informativo e di divulgazione. Per esso non è possibile garantire che sia esente da errori o inesattezze, per cui l’amministratore di questo Sito non assume alcuna responsabilità come indicato nelle note legali pubblicate in Termini e Condizioni
Quanto è stato utile questo articolo?
0
Vota per primo questo articolo!